Clock wont show 12hr on instrument cluster

For some reason the clock on the instrument cluster under the temperature wont show the time in 12hr mode, it shows 24hr style. On the idrive it shows 12hr, in settings i checked and its in 12hr mode. But when i switch it to 24hr in settings it doesnt seem to accept the setting. Anybody have any idea what is going on? Can coding fix this problem?
